Fabiane Bach is a scholar working on Food Science, Biochemistry and Pharmacology. According to data from OpenAlex, Fabiane Bach has authored 13 papers receiving a total of 377 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Food Science, 6 papers in Biochemistry and 4 papers in Pharmacology. Recurrent topics in Fabiane Bach’s work include Phytochemicals and Antioxidant Activities (5 papers), Botanical Research and Applications (3 papers) and Fungal Biology and Applications (3 papers). Fabiane Bach is often cited by papers focused on Phytochemicals and Antioxidant Activities (5 papers), Botanical Research and Applications (3 papers) and Fungal Biology and Applications (3 papers). Fabiane Bach collaborates with scholars based in Brazil, United States and Mexico. Fabiane Bach's co-authors include Charles Windson Isidoro Haminiuk, Giselle Maria Maciel, Marcelo Barba Bellettini, Cristiane Vieira Helm, Alessandra Cristina Pedro, Ana Paula Stafussa, Acácio Antônio Ferreira Zielinski, Suélen Ávila, Fabiane Hamerski and Marcos L. Corazza and has published in prestigious journals such as American Journal of Ophthalmology, LWT and Scientia Horticulturae.
